Key Responsibilities

  • •Design, develop, and optimize Low-Code/No-Code apps and automations aligned with business requirements.
  • •Support operation and maintenance of existing Power Platform solutions.
  • •Collaborate with IT and business stakeholders to gather requirements and translate processes into technical solutions.
  • •Integrate Low-Code/No-Code apps and automations with Microsoft Dataverse, SharePoint, and external data sources using custom connectors or APIs.
  • •Strategically deploy AI tools and automation solutions that add value to daily business operations.

Key Requirements

  • •Currently enrolled in a relevant degree program (Computer Science, IT, or related field).
  • •Good German language skills (minimum B2) for collaboration with German-speaking colleagues and stakeholders.
  • •Familiarity with Low-Code/No-Code tools (Microsoft Power Platform or n8n) and the Microsoft technology stack.
  • •Analytical mindset with a hands-on approach to problem-solving.
  • •Excited about new technologies, curious, self-motivated, and eager to develop technical skills.

Company Brief

Roland Berger
Roland Berger is a global management consulting firm advising businesses and public-sector organizations on strategy, transformation, operations, and digital topics. It serves clients across industries through offices in major markets worldwide.
